The energy transition requires active local governance, capable of connecting global challenges with the specific opportunities of each territory. In this context, the Latin American Network of Energy Cities (Red LACE) has established itself as a pioneering platform for cooperation among municipalities, ministries, and strategic actors in the region, promoting innovative models of local energy management.
This meeting aims to highlight the accumulated experience of Red LACE and foster an in-depth dialogue on the challenges and opportunities facing energy cities in Latin America and the Caribbean on their path toward sustainability. Through a multi-stakeholder exchange, lessons learned, success stories, and future perspectives will be shared to strengthen municipal energy management capacity and advance toward more sustainable, inclusive, and resilient territories.
